The Sherpa of Nepal

The Sherpa of Nepal, numbering approximately 201,000 people, are Engaged yet Unreached. They are described as a Tibetan ethnic group native to the most mountainous regions of Nepal, Tingri County in the Tibet Autonomous Region and the Himalayas They are an Indigenous people, with Sherpa as their ethnic/kinship group and are in the Tibetan people cluster of the Tibetan Peoples. Their primary religion is Tibetan Buddhism. They primarily speak Sherpa.
